The Russian Armed Forces reached the outskirts of Sudzha during a counteroffensive in the Kursk region. According to Mash, the attack aircraft gained a foothold in the area of ​​the Lotus gas station in the southeast of the city – it was from this point that the active phase of the invasion of Ukrainian troops began. Besides this:
“Our people took control of the Sudzha-Belaya highway.
— The assault on Martynovka began, a village seven kilometers east of Sudzha. Marines from the legendary 810th Brigade and the international special forces “Akhmat” work there. Control of this place will allow the RF Armed Forces to occupy commanding heights above Sudzha.
— The advance of the 155th and 106th brigades continues towards the north-west of Sudzha – from the direction of already partially controlled Lyubimovka. Our people are surrounding the VSUshnikov.
— During the five days of the second stage of the counteroffensive, the Russian Armed Forces liberated 11 settlements: the village of Zeleny Shlyakh, the village of Leonidovo, the settlement of Mikhailovka, the villages of Novy Put and Medvezhye, as well as the villages of Nizhny Klin, Lyubimovka, Novoivanovka, Olgovka, Tolsty Lug, Sheptukhovka.
